Impactful cover letters can make the difference between a job seeker’s resume being read or deleted. If you are using job search engines to post for positions online, there may be an opportunity to upload a cover letter along with your resume. When sending your resume to a prospective employer via email, the cover letter becomes the body of the email.
- Keep the cover letter short and directly focused at the job description.
- Include information that separates your skills from the competition – language, technology, specifics about training you have had.
- Note if you are being referred by an employee so the hiring manager can check with that person and get a direct reference.
- Explain your key reason for interest in the position and how your background is a fit for what they are looking for.
